个人意见,仅供参考:smallint是有符号或无符号2字节的整数,范围是0~65,536,5位整数bigint是有符号或无符号8字节的整数,范围是0~18,446,744,073,709,551,616,20位整数所以,smallint-->number(5),bigint--> ...
number默认情况下,精度为 位,取值范围 之间 它实际上是磁盘上的一个变长类型,会占用 字节的存储空间。 只知道默认小数点位是 , ORACLE NUMBER数据类型 网上关于number的资料很多了,学习总结了下,如果问题及不足,欢迎指正。 一 oracle的number类型精度 刻度范围 number p,s p: s: 有效数位:从左边第一个不为 的数算起,小数点和负号不计入有效位数。 ...
2008-11-17 14:40 0 7390 推荐指数:
个人意见,仅供参考:smallint是有符号或无符号2字节的整数,范围是0~65,536,5位整数bigint是有符号或无符号8字节的整数,范围是0~18,446,744,073,709,551,616,20位整数所以,smallint-->number(5),bigint--> ...
在ORACLE数据库中,NUMBER(P,S)是最常见的数字类型,可以存放数据范围为10^-130~10^126(不包含此值),需要1~22字节(BYTE)不等的存储空间。P 是Precison的英文缩写,即精度缩写,表示有效数字的位数,最多不能超过38个有效数字。S是Scale的英文缩写,表示 ...
Number可以通过如下格式来指定:Field_NAME Number(precision ,scale),其中precision指Number可以存储的最大数字长度(不包括左右两边的0),scale指在小数点右边的最大数字长度(包括左侧0)。也就是说, ...
NUMBER类型详细介绍: 在Oracle中Number类型可以用来存储0,正负定点或者浮点数,可表示的数据范围在 1.0 * 10(-130) —— 9.9...9 * 10(125) {38个9后边带88个0} 的数字,当Oracle中的数学表达式的值>=1.0*10(126)时 ...
number 数据类型 number (precision,scale) a) precision表示数字中的有效位,如果没有指定precision的话,oracle将使用38作为精度; b) 如果scale大于零,表示数字精度到小数点右边的位数;scale默认 ...
https://www.cnblogs.com/oumyye/p/4448656.html NUMBER ( precision, scale) precision表示数字中的有效位;如果没有指定precision的话,Oracle将使用38作为精度。 如果scale大于零,表示 ...
INT类型是NUMBER类型的子类型。下面简要说明:(1)NUMBER(P,S)该数据类型用于定义数字类型的数据,其中P表示数字的总位数(最大字节个数),而S则表示小数点后面的位数。假设定义SAL列为NUMBER(6,2)则整数最大位数为4位(6-2=4),而小数最大位数为2位。(2)INT类型 ...
前言 话说Java中String是有长度限制的,听到这里很多人不禁要问,String还有长度限制?是的有,而且在JVM编译中还有规范,而且有的家人们在面试的时候也遇到了。 本人就遇到过面试的时候问这个的,而且在之前开发的中也真实地遇到过这个String长度限制的场景(将某固定文件转码成 ...